The DTSC-50 ATS Controller is a device designed for the automatic transfer of power between a main power source (mains) and a generator, ensuring continuous power supply. It is a comprehensive generator set controller that provides essential functions for managing and protecting generator systems.
Function Description
The DTSC-50 ATS Controller serves as a central control unit for generator sets, offering a range of functionalities including:
- Generator Control: It manages the starting and stopping of the generator, ensuring smooth transitions during power outages or fluctuations.
- Engine and Generator Protection: The controller incorporates various protection features to safeguard the engine and generator from potential damage. This includes monitoring for overspeed, underspeed, overvoltage, undervoltage, and other critical parameters.
- Engine Data Measurement: It measures and displays key engine data such as battery voltage, service hours, and other relevant operational statistics.
- Generator Voltage Measurement: The device accurately measures generator voltage, providing real-time data for monitoring and control.
- Alarm Display with Circuit Breaker Trip and Engine Shutdown: In the event of an alarm condition, the DTSC-50 displays the alarm and can initiate a circuit breaker trip or engine shutdown to prevent further damage.
- AMF (Automatic Mains Failure) Standby Genset Control: It supports automatic mains failure functionality, allowing the generator to start automatically when the mains power fails and to stop when mains power is restored. This includes open transition and closed transition breaker control.
- Password Protected Configuration: The controller features password protection for its configuration settings, ensuring that only authorized personnel can make changes.
- Display and Operation: The DTSC-50 features a 7-segment LED display for showing all measurement data and operating conditions. It has dedicated buttons for various operations, including manual start/stop, acknowledging alarms, and navigating through menus. The display provides information on generator voltage, mains voltage, frequency, and other critical parameters.
- Event Logging: The controller logs events, providing a historical record of operations and faults. This is crucial for troubleshooting and maintenance.
- Communication Interfaces: It includes interfaces for communication, such as RS-232/USB for PC connection and Modbus RTU Slave for integration into larger control systems.
Important Technical Specifications
The DTSC-50 ATS Controller is designed for robust performance and ease of integration.
- Power Supply: The device operates on a DC power supply, typically ranging from 6.5 to 32.0 Vdc. It is crucial to ensure that the engine is shut down by an external device in case of power supply failure to the DTSC-50 control unit, as failure to do so may result in damages to the equipment.
- Voltage Measurement:
- Generator: The controller supports various generator voltage measurement configurations, including 3-phase 4-wire (3Ph 4W), 3-phase 3-wire (3Ph 3W), 1-phase 3-wire (1Ph 3W), and 1-phase 2-wire (1Ph 2W). The measurement is performed phase-neutral (WYE connected system) or phase-phase (delta connected system). The voltage inputs for generator measurement are typically rated for 480 Vac and use 2.5 mm² wiring.
- Mains: Similar to generator voltage, mains voltage measurement supports 3-phase 4-wire (3Ph 4W), 3-phase 3-wire (3Ph 3W), and 1-phase 3-wire (1Ph 3W) configurations. The voltage inputs for mains measurement are typically rated for 480 Vac and use 2.5 mm² wiring.
- Discrete Inputs: The DTSC-50 has discrete inputs for bipolar signals and operation logic, allowing for flexible integration with various sensors and control devices.
- Relay Outputs: It provides relay outputs for controlling external devices, such as circuit breakers and engine start/stop mechanisms.
- Housing and Dimensions: The controller has a compact design for panel mounting. The housing dimensions are 158 mm (height) x 158 mm (width) x 40 mm (depth). The panel cut-out dimensions are 136 mm (height) x 136 mm (width), with a tolerance of ±1.0 mm.
- Software Version: The manual specifies a software version of 1.00xx or higher, indicating ongoing development and improvements.
Usage Features
The DTSC-50 is designed for user-friendly operation and configuration:
- Operating Modes: It supports various operating modes, including STOP, MANUAL, and AUTOMATIC, allowing operators to choose the appropriate mode for their application.
- Configuration: The controller can be configured via the front panel or using a PC with dedicated software (LeoPC1). This allows for detailed customization of parameters, including thresholds for alarms, operating sequences, and communication settings.
- Parameter Access Level: The device features different parameter access levels, ensuring that critical settings are protected from unauthorized changes.
- HMI (Human Machine Interface): The front panel with its LED display and buttons provides a clear and intuitive interface for monitoring and basic control.
- Modbus Protocol: The implementation of Modbus protocol allows for seamless integration into existing SCADA or building management systems, enabling remote monitoring and control.
- Event Log: The event log stores critical operational data, which can be accessed for diagnostics and performance analysis.
- Direct Connection Cable (DPC): For PC configuration, a Direct Connection Cable DPC (P/N 5417-857) and a notebook/PC with the software LeoPC1 are required. Parameters indicated with an 'L' in the parameter description can be configured from page 52 onwards.
